              Well if you want to connect to official servers, good luck finding anyone. I hear they're dead. Plus you need the EU or JP official copy, with unused HL codes etc.

              To get onto the hacked servs using DC, you need to have a codebreaker (or download it) and hook your DC up through your PC via ICS. You can do this with any copy of the game, AFAIK.

              Google "Schtack server" or something, and the website they have will explain all.
